And those rechargeable batteries are typically made of lithium, which isn't compatible with many battery-powered products. He said it's a cheaper solution than rechargeable batteries. At that price, Roohparvar, the technology "pays for itself" after just one purchase - a typical AA battery costs $2.50, and the Batteriser makes one battery last as long as eight. The Batteriser will come in AA, AAA, C and D-cell varieties and sell for less than $10 for a pack of four. home has 28 battery-operated devices inside. There are 5.4 billion battery-operated devices in the wild, and 15 billion disposable batteries are bought every year around the world. Roohparvar says he hopes to shake up the $14 billion disposable battery market. Roohparvar claims that the Batteriser can get 1,185 minutes out of a remote (5 times more energy), 570 minutes out of portable speakers (6x) or 355 minutes out of an RC toy (9x).īatteriser can continue to deliver a 1.5 volt charge from batteries that have actually discharged down to 0.6 volts. For example, a typical AA battery will stop working after 240 minutes of use powering a remote control, 95 minutes powering portable speakers, or just 38 minutes powering an RC toy.
